Transaction 255656eb8529a7d7e94ed9d865bda694536107b84f46bf58c13a34c8e05c0bb3

1 Input
2 Outputs
  • 255656eb8529a7d7e94ed9d865bda694536107b84f46bf58c13a34c8e05c0bb3:0
  • value  35603566
    address  1EpJSC6K8TBrRFTJSRBHGk56zC1vkmAoMP
  • 255656eb8529a7d7e94ed9d865bda694536107b84f46bf58c13a34c8e05c0bb3:1
  • value  773134
    address  1PFtrRjbq4aLfM7k4tyLZ3ZAuTsgLr6Q8Q